What The Bible Says About Finance

The Bible contains over 2,000 verses about money and possessions — more than any other topic except love. Here are scriptural guidelines organized by financial topic, paired with podcast episodes that bring each principle to life.

Seeking Wise Counsel

Proverbs 19:20
"Listen to advice and accept instruction, and in the end you will be wise."
Proverbs 15:22
"Plans fail for lack of counsel, but with many advisers they succeed."
Psalm 1:1
"Blessed is the man who does not walk in the counsel of the wicked or stand in the way of sinners or sit in the seat of mockers."
Psalm 32:8
"I will instruct you and teach you in the way you should go; I will counsel you and watch over you."

Saving & Investing

Proverbs 21:5
"The plans of the diligent lead to profit as surely as haste leads to poverty."
Proverbs 30:25
"Ants are creatures of little strength, yet they store up their food in the summer."
Ecclesiastes 11:2
"Give portions to seven, yes to eight, for you do not know what disaster may come upon the land."
Proverbs 6:6-8
"Go to the ant, you sluggard; consider its ways and be wise! It has no commander, no overseer or ruler, yet it stores its provisions in summer and gathers its food at harvest."

Honesty

1 Corinthians 4:1-2
"So then, men ought to regard us as servants of Christ and as those entrusted with the secret things of God. Now it is required that those who have been given a trust must prove faithful."
Proverbs 13:11
"Dishonest money dwindles away, but he who gathers money little by little makes it grow."
Proverbs 12:19
"Truthful lips endure forever, but a lying tongue lasts only a moment."

Debt

Proverbs 22:7
"The rich rule over the poor, and the borrower is servant to the lender."
Luke 16:10-13
"Whoever can be trusted with very little can also be trusted with much... You cannot serve both God and Money."
Proverbs 22:26-27
"Do not be a man who strikes hands in pledge or puts up security for debts; if you lack the means to pay, your very bed will be snatched from under you."

Giving

Proverbs 11:25
"A generous man will prosper; he who refreshes others will himself be refreshed."
2 Corinthians 9:6-7
"Whoever sows sparingly will also reap sparingly, and whoever sows generously will also reap generously. Each man should give what he has decided in his heart to give, not reluctantly or under compulsion, for God loves a cheerful giver."

Tithing

Proverbs 3:9-10
"Honor the Lord with your wealth, with the first fruits of all your crops; then your barns will be filled to overflowing."
Malachi 3:8-10
"Will a man rob God? Yet you rob me. But you ask, 'How do we rob you?' In tithes and offerings... Bring the whole tithe into the storehouse... Test me in this, says the Lord Almighty, and see if I will not throw open the floodgates of heaven and pour out so much blessing that you will not have room enough for it."

Ownership

Psalm 24:1
"The earth is the Lord's, and everything in it, the world and all who live in it."
Haggai 2:8
"'The silver is mine and the gold is mine,' declares the Lord Almighty."
Leviticus 25:23
"The land must not be sold permanently, because the land is mine and you are but aliens and my tenants."
